The Influence of Western Cooking Styles on India’s Poultry Products

The culinary landscape of India is as diverse as its culture, with each region offering unique flavors and cooking techniques. However, in recent years, Western cooking styles have significantly influenced the way poultry products are prepared and consumed in India. This article explores how Western culinary trends have permeated Indian kitchens and the effects they have on poultry products.

One of the most prominent influences of Western cooking on Indian poultry dishes is the method of preparation. Traditional Indian cooking typically involves intricate spice blends and slow-cooking techniques. In contrast, many Western cooking styles favor simpler seasoning and faster cooking methods. For instance, the incorporation of grilling or roasting methods has gained popularity in Indian households. Dishes like tandoori chicken have evolved, incorporating marinades that highlight herbs like rosemary and thyme, which are staples in Western cuisines.

Another noteworthy impact of Western cooking styles is the rise of global fast-food chains in India. These establishments have introduced a new way of consuming poultry products, with items like fried chicken burgers and chicken wraps becoming staples for the modern Indian consumer. The convenience of fast food has changed eating habits, leading many to opt for these ready-to-eat meals over traditional home-cooked options.

The health consciousness that is prevalent in Western countries has also made its way into Indian cooking practices. As more Indians become aware of health and nutrition, there is a growing trend to seek healthier poultry options. This includes opting for organic and free-range chicken, influenced by Western preferences for ethically-sourced food. Additionally, cooking techniques that maintain the nutritional value of poultry, such as steaming or grilling, are becoming increasingly popular.

Moreover, Western cooking styles have introduced a variety of ingredients and flavors to the Indian palate. Ingredients like garlic, cream, and mustard—common in Western poultry recipes—are increasingly being used in Indian cooking. This fusion has led to innovative dishes such as chicken pasta with local spices, which merges Western recipes with Indian flavors, offering a unique culinary experience.

Social media also plays a significant role in spreading new cooking trends, fueled by influences from Western chefs and food bloggers. Indian home cooks are now experimenting with international recipes, showcasing their results on platforms like Instagram and YouTube. This trend not only promotes innovation in cooking but also encourages a cross-cultural exchange of culinary ideas.

As the influence of Western cooking styles continues to evolve in India, it is clear that the poultry sector will keep adapting. The combination of traditional Indian techniques with modern Western methods results in a richer, more diverse food experience that appeals to a wide range of consumers. This fusion of culinary practices is not just a trend but represents a larger cultural shift towards embracing global influences while honoring local traditions.
